Pre-race routine:

Had to get up really early to get out by 4:30 for the 90-minute trip up to Lum's Pond. Ate half a bagel and some cinnamon toast.
Event warmup:

Got into the water a little before the start to get acclimated to the chill factor.
Swim
  • 30m 10s
  • 880 yards
  • 03m 26s / 100 yards
Comments:

Getting to the first buoy didn't seem to take that long, but from there to the next seemed to take forever; took several minutes before I could even spot it since we were swimming into the rising sun. I focused on the flailing arms and legs in front of me, water droplets and wetsuits shimmering, and at a couple of notches in the trees to stay more or less on the proper line. Even from there to the end seemed long. And I pretty much followed my swimming plan, with no really long breast stroking breaks. In the end, with my Garmin reading almost 1200 yards, I'm guessing this course came in somewhere between 1000-1100 (discounting the 100 or so yards from the beach into transition).

Despite my not liking this course, I was making reasonably decent time until I seriously twisted an ankle (hope that's all it is) on one of those roots or rocks. I actually hit all fours as a result, came up with a bloody scraped knee in addition to the ankle issue. Guess I'm lucky I didn't do anything to my hands or wrists. This happened at around the two-mile point. I walked for a good bit after the incident, then did some shuffling/jogging interspersed with walking for the remainder of the race, so I'm guessing the last 1.3 miles took 15-16 minutes. Quite a bummer since I'm concerned it might result in a season-ender...Hoping for some good recovery over the next three weeks.
What would you do differently?:

Not pick an event with an off-road run course. I know people love running on trails, but I've never been comfortable with anything more than a gravel road. I knew there was off road paths to this run, but didn't realize it would be to this extent. Probably would've done it anyway, but going forward? Nope...will be pavement only for me.

Event comments:

Despite the overall organization, something seemed off about this race and not up to Piranha's normal standards. I know the owner is retiring and he's sold the company and the races, so maybe that had an effect, but it just seemed like they were phoning it in today.
